The issue I'm getting is with rosdep, it fails on a homebrew command:
ERROR: the following rosdeps failed to install
homebrew: command [brew install ros/kinetic/gazebo_ros_pkgs] failed
After going through rosdep source code, I found that the way that the name of homebrew formulae are created might not work anymore. In get_gbprepo_as_rosdep_data method in gbpdistro_support.py, name of a formula is created by chaining together tap, release name and rosdep_key:
homebrew_name = '%s/%s/%s' % (tap, release_name, rosdep_key)
After that, 'brew install' is called with this homebrew_name:
executing command [brew install ros/kinetic/gazebo_ros_pkgs]
However homebrew doesn't work with "ros/kinetic/gazebo_ros_pkgs":
Error: No available formula with the name "ros/kinetic/gazebo_ros_pkgs"
Please tap it and then try again: brew tap ros/kinetic
executing command [brew install ros/kinetic/gazebo_ros_pkgs]
==> Tapping ros/kinetic
Cloning into '/usr/local/Homebrew/Library/Taps/ros/homebrew-kinetic'...
remote: Repository not found.
fatal: repository 'https://github.com/ros/homebrew-kinetic/' not found
Error: Failure while executing: git clone https://github.com/ros/homebrew-kinetic /usr/local/Homebrew/Library/Taps/ros/homebrew-kinetic --depth=1
ERROR: the following rosdeps failed to install
This renders resdep not functioning on macOS.
